The high target affinity and specificity of RNAi therapeutics are the key drivers for the growth of the market.
RNAi therapeutics demonstrate remarkable effectiveness against their specific targets. RNAi molecules bind to target genes with exceptional affinity, facilitated by complementary base pairing that involves hydrogen bond formation in nucleic acids. This high-affinity binding enables RNAi and antisense oligonucleotides to regulate gene expression through various mechanisms. Some key advantages of RNAi therapeutics include their ability to target virtually any gene in the genome, their high potency and long-lasting effects, and their ability to be administered through multiple routes, including intravenous, subcutaneous, and inhalation delivery. The increasing R&D for RNAi therapy by vendors is the primary trend in the market. Vendors operating in the market have increased their focus on R&D for RNAi therapy to expand their offerings. For instance, In June 2022, Alnylam initiated platform advancements that enabled the development of a new conjugate technology, C16. With a new conjugate, RNAi therapy can target new extrahepatic tissues, including the eye, the lung, and the central nervous system. Phase 1 ALN-APP program in early-onset Alzheimer's disease is the first clinical program to utilize C16.
Moreover, in November 2021, Novo Nordisk entered into a definitive agreement to acquire Dicerna Pharmaceuticals (Dicerna). Dicerna focuses on RNAi-based therapeutics. Moreover, the RNAi platform from Dicerna to Novo Nordisk's already existing research technology platforms strengthens the company's objective of utilizing a wide variety of technology platforms that apply to all its therapeutic emphasis areas. The high price of RNAi drugs is the major challenge in the market. RNAi-based drugs are very effective for the treatment of various chronic diseases, However, their high price makes them unaffordable for the patients. Manufacturers of RNAi-based drugs are investing huge sums in the R&D of these kinds of therapies. Factors such as a highly technically skilled workforce and complex manufacturing and scaling-up facilities are responsible for the high prices of these drugs.
Moreover, after 16 years of continuous research and USD 2.5 billion in investments, Alnylam offers ONPATTRO for the treatment of hATTR amyloidosis, which costs around USD 450,000 per patient. However, most counties across the world do not have reimbursement policies for such expensive therapies.
